Abstract

The invention relates to a manufacture method of high-strength plastic. The method comprises the following steps: (1) taking and adding a certain amount of a corrosion inhibitor into a certain amountof rosin and heating; (2) mixing wax, a stabilizer, a preservative, tricaprylyl citrate and acetin, and putting the mixture into a certain amount of rosin to heat; (3) mixing mixtures respectively obtained in step (1) and step (2), and carrying out constant-temperature heating in a water bath kettle; (4) adding a certain amount of stabilizer into the mixture, which is heated in step (3), at intervals, and carrying out stable chemical property treatment on the mixture; (5) adding a mold resistant agent, iron powder and an antioxidant into the mixture in a fusion state in step (4) and carrying out mixed fusion treatment; (6) carrying out heating operation for a certain period of time on the mixture obtained in step (5); and (7) cooling the mixture obtained in step (6), and curing and moldingon a molding machine.

technical field [0001] The invention relates to the technical field of plastic production, in particular to a production method of high-strength plastic. Background technique [0002] With the progress of society, people's living standards are getting higher and higher, and more and more cars have entered people's lives. Since our country is a large country with a large population, the consumption is also huge. The automobile industry is developing very fast, and the current automobile materials focus on environmental protection and lightweight, but many parts of the automobile cannot be replaced by plastics, and the body load-bearing parts are still made of metal. Existing plastic products cannot be used for automobile load-bearing due to insufficient strength. Problems with parts.
